A meditative picture book about the power of reading and how one child can change the world, from #1 bestselling author Andrea Beaty

One girl. One spark.

Faint and fading in the dark.

Flicker . . . Flicker . . . Flicker . . . Glow.

Tiny ember. Burning low.

Inspired by the global movement to empower girls through education, this lyrical story tells of one small girl who reads a book that lights a spark. She shares what she learns with her class, and the spark grows. The girl is then moved to write her own story, which she shares with girls around the globe, and it ignites a spark in them, lighting up the whole world. This heartwarming and moving narrative shows how books and education can inspire change and how one child can make a huge difference.

Andrea Beaty
Andrea Beaty is the author of many beloved children's books, including the bestselling Questioneers series, I Love You Like Yellow, Happy Birthday, Madame Chapeau, and One Girl. She lives just outside Chicago.

David Roberts has illustrated many children's books, including the bestselling Questioneers series. He lives in London. Andrea and David are both executive producers of the Emmy Award-winning show Ada Twist, Scientist on Netflix.
